About Us
Insteel Industries, established in 1953, started from humble beginnings, embraces strong values, and has its Home Office in Mount Airy, NC. We are the nation's largest manufacturer of steel wire reinforcing products for concrete construction applications. We manufacture and market prestressed concrete (PC) strand and welded wire reinforcement, including engineered structural mesh, concrete pipe reinforcement, and standard welded wire reinforcement for concrete reinforcement applications. The company operates ten manufacturing facilities in eight states.

Position Snapshot
A Quality Assurance Technician is commonly expected to perform, maintain, troubleshoot, and provide guidance for quality and ASTM standards. You will provide support for all production employees and work daily to ensure assigned areas of responsibility are working at risk lowered to ALARA specifically to achieve ZERO HARM. To perform well in this role, you will need to:
  • Audit production procedures and submit summary reports to production supervisors, as well as the General Manager.
  • Sample and test raw materials according to ASTM standards.
  • Use load measuring machines, micrometers, calipers, slip gauges, extensometers, tachometers, metal scales, and other provided equipment need.
  • Ensure proper training of production employees in quality testing equipment and standards to include micrometers.
  • Initiate and suggest plans to improve quality performance, subject to approval by Insteel leadership.
  • Use judgment to plan, perform, and make decisions within the limitations of recognized or standard methods and procedures.
  • Files all test results and test sheets as required.
  • Identifies potential quality issues.
  • Conducts pin tests, chuck efficiency tests, pull-out tests, 30-minute relaxation tests, 1000-hour relaxation tests, elongation checks, wire drawing heat checks, counter checks, band tension, and all other procedures considered as auditing or special testing.
